Find your jack kit, there should be 2 extension rods with square ends on them. You'll find a small pop off plate on the bumper, assemble the extension rods and stick them in the opening (you can look from underneath to see where the rod needs to hit). Once you're locked on use the supplied tool to turn the rods...this lowers or raises the spare tire.
This is common on most GM trucks/SUVS from 06 and up. My concern would be why it's loose. If you've never used the spare the system should have remained in it's factory position. It's possible your truck slipped through a lazy GM employee who did not ensure the spare tire winch system was at spec. If you secure the tire and it loosens again in the near future chances are the little winch is no good. I'd imagine you're still under warranty, if this occurs take it in and have it replaced.
